Job description

At UnitedHealthcare, we're simplifying the health care experience, creating healthier communities and removing barriers to quality care. The work you do here impacts the lives of millions of people for the better. Come build the health care system of tomorrow, making it more responsive, affordable and equitable. Ready to make a difference? Join us to start Caring. Connecting. Growing together.



You'll enjoy the flexibility to work remotely * from anywhere within the U.S. as you take on some tough challenges.



Primary Responsibilities:



  • Prepare provider income statements

  • Reconcile, analyze and review network income statements in preparation for month end close

  • Research stakeholder questions and provide solutions

  • Document process changes and procedural documents

  • Coordinate with other teams both internally and externally involved with the process

  • Must be comfortable working with complex Excel spreadsheets, calculations, and pivot tables

  • Assist in developing and maintaining clear communication channels with key stakeholders both internally and externally

  • Skilled at problem solving, follow-through and resolution

  • Ensure sufficient documentation is available (and provided) to support audits including current/historical documentation of operational procedures and incentive records

  • Perform analyses of issues, participate in development of potential solutions, and make recommendations to ensure accurate and timely resolution

  • Recommend and drive process improvements with potential utilization of VBA and SAS

  • Generally, work is self-directed and not prescribed

  • Serves as a resource to others

  • Experience with financial operations is beneficial

  • Other projects as assigned



You'll be rewarded and recognized for your performance in an environment that will challenge you and give you clear direction on what it takes to succeed in your role as well as provide development for other roles you may be interested in.

Required Qualifications:



  • Bachelor's degree in finance, accounting, or a related field

  • 3+ years of financial and operational management experience

  • 2+ years financial statement analysis experience

  • 1+ years writing code using VBA

  • 1+ years of experience writing VBA code

  • Advanced MS Excel experience

  • Work experience anticipating accounting, financial reporting, forecasting, and operational issues, assessing their implications, and developing and implementing an appropriate action plan

  • Proven experience driving business performance in a corporate environment

  • Proven ability to learn and understand the interdependencies of computer systems quickly

  • Proven ability to work collaboratively and influence across a matrix environment to drive revenue enhancement and expense management initiatives

  • Proven ability to help others work independently, prioritize work and meet deadlines

  • Proven solid verbal/written communication skills; Ability to communicate effectively with multiple levels within and outside the company. Possesses written communication skills enabling independent handling of correspondence and proofreading of complex legal agreements, letters, reports and other documents

  • Demonstrated customer service skills in a professional business environment; Tact, diplomacy, and sensitivity to respect confidential information

  • Work schedule flexibility, including availability for overtime/weekend work as needed



Preferred:



  • Work experience with SAS



*All employees working remotely will be required to adhere to UnitedHealth Group's Telecommuter Policy



Pay is based on several factors including but not limited to local labor markets, education, work experience, certifications, etc. In addition to your salary, we offer benefits such as, a comprehensive benefits package, incentive and recognition programs, equity stock purchase and 401k contribution (all benefits are subject to eligibility requirements). No matter where or when you begin a career with us, you'll find a far-reaching choice of benefits and incentives. The salary for this role will range from $71,200 to $127,200 annually based on full-time employment. We comply with all minimum wage laws as applicable.
